The Lost Bloch

Published by Subterranean Press; all volumes edited by David J. Schow

​​The Lost Bloch: Volume 1: The Devil With You! (1999; limited edition of 724 numbered and 26 lettered hardcover copies) Cover by Bernie Wrightson.
  • Of Pennies, Pulps and Penury - essay by David J. Schow
  • Foreword (The Devil with You!) - essay by Stefan Dziemianowicz
  • The Devil with You (1950)
  • Strictly from Mars (1948)
  • It Happened Tomorrow (1943)
  • The Big Binge (1955)
  • An Hour with Robert Bloch - interview of Robert Bloch by David J. Schow

The Lost Bloch: Volume 2: Hell on Earth (2000; limited edition of 1250 numbered and 26 lettered hardcover copies) Cover by Bernie Wrightson.
  • From Here, I Can See Four Blochs - essay by David J. Schow
  • Lost and Found - essay by Douglas E. Winter
  • Hell on Earth (1942)
  • The Miracle of Ronald Weems (1955)
  • It's a Small World (1944)
  • Once a Sucker (1952)
  • Twice a Sucker - essay by David J. Schow
  • Slightly More Than Another Hour with Robert Bloch - interview of Robert Bloch by Larry Ditillio and J. Michael Straczynsk

​The Lost Bloch: Volume 3: Crimes and Punishments (2002; limited edition of 750 numbered and 26 lettered hardcover copies) Cover by Bernie Wrightson.
  • The Head on the Bloch - essay by David J. Schow
  • Weird Adventures of the Odd Little Band - essay by Gahan Wilson
  • The Shambles of Ed Gein (non-fiction; 1962) – essay by Robert Bloch
  • Hell's Angel (1951)
  • The Finger Necklace (1945)
  • The Noose Hangs High (1946)
  • It's Your Own Funeral (1943)
  • Dr. Holmes' Murder Castle - essay by Robert Bloch
  • Three Whole Hours and Then Some with Robert Bloch - essay by Douglas E. Winter
  • My Husband, Robert Bloch - essay by Eleanor Bloch​
